What is it?
Enterprise File Sync and Share (EFSS) Solutions involve using software to enable secure file sharing and synchronization across devices and users within an organization. EFSS solutions allow employees to access and collaborate on files from any location while maintaining data security. Key aspects include file synchronization, access control, and collaboration. Effective EFSS solutions are essential for improving productivity, ensuring data security, and enabling remote work.

What to watch out for?
Key principles of EFSS include file synchronization, ensuring that files are consistently updated and accessible across all devices and users, whether through real-time syncing, version control, or offline access, enabling seamless collaboration and file management. Access control is crucial for ensuring that only authorized users can access, edit, or share files, whether through role-based access, encryption, or secure sharing links, protecting sensitive data and ensuring compliance with security policies. Collaboration is important for enabling users to work together on files, whether through shared folders, commenting, or real-time co-editing, improving productivity and teamwork.
